Broccoli with Mustard Sauce

Yield: 4 servings
Prep: 10 min

Ingredients

  • 4 tablespoons water, divided
  • 1 tablespoon butter, melted
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 pound fresh broccoli, cut into florets (4 cups)
  • 1 tablespoon canola oil

Directions

  1. In a small bowl, combine 1 tablespoon water, butter, brown sugar and mustard; set aside.
  2. In a skillet or wok, stir-fry broccoli in oil for 1 minute; add remaining water. Reduce heat; cover and cook for 3-4 minutes or until crisp-tender. Add mustard sauce and toss to coat.
